…Mahasāsika also split into many sects, but the Sūtrabhāsita sect in northern India left behind the Mahāvastu (the Great Works of the Buddha). Southern India is dominated by Mahāsāsika sects, but is sometimes referred to as the Andhra sect regionally. The Theravāda sect, which spread to Sri Lanka, is also known as the Pratyāsita sect, and has a complete set of sacred texts in Pāli that are still preserved to this day. … *Some of the terminology that refers to the Andhra sect is listed below.
